Productivity seems to be a favorite word among managers and employers, and for a good reason. In today’s world, it is incredibly difficult to run a successful business, simply because there is so much competition out there. This is why so many employers push their employees to work harder, to work longer, which does produce results, up to a certain point, after which they risk employee burnout. The number of hours worked is not always directly proportional to productivity and company’s bottom line.

As you can see, making your employees more productive doesn’t necessarily mean making them work more or paying them more. A simple appreciation for all of their hard work can go a long way, not to mention all the small, but important perks that can make their stay at the office just a little bit more comfortable and pleasant.
